Output 8842d5af775b1bf040666cc59f6d69ff25e2c20e285bcb30abb108bb7607095e:109

value
1330736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c2ec4176bd332397d285b5ec3c7238c66b1d32 OP_EQUAL
address
DG4LTZipHTTqpod31qLBW9kMAGKeSt9xBT
transaction
8842d5af775b1bf040666cc59f6d69ff25e2c20e285bcb30abb108bb7607095e
spent
true